#2348e2 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#2348e2 is composed of 13.7% red, 28.2% green and 88.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 84.5% cyan, 68.1% magenta, 0% yellow and 11.4% black. It has a hue angle of 228.4 degrees, a saturation of 76.7% and a lightness of 51.2%. #2348e2 color hex could be obtained by blending #4690ff with #0000c5. Closest websafe color is: #3333cc.

Shades and Tints of #2348e2

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010205 is the darkest color, while #f3f5fd is the lightest one.

Tones of #2348e2

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#797d8c is the less saturated color, while #0636ff is the most saturated one.
